And so I arrived on Ko Tao - Turtle Island, so called because it is shaped like a turtle diving toward Ko Pha Ngan 40km to the south (see I did read my guidebook!!). I spent my first day finding my feet and then going to SLEEP! I live in a bungalow, a 1 room + bathroom wooden shack on stilts, with a very hard bed (no blanket but 2 slight mouldy smelling pillows) and a small wicker shelving unit, a cold shower (all the showers here are cold) and about 73 geckos!! Including on massive one out on the balcony, that is blue with reddish brown markings and I kid you not is about a metre nose to tail-end. It’s nice though, it just makes a lot of noise when it’s wound up. Well to ... read more
